Since Bxd7 seems silly, and Bd3 essentially amounts to giving black the
move ...a6 for free (and it's a move often played in these positions) I
think a6 is a completely legitimate choice of move here.

The real question is whether the pawn grab with Bxf1, Qh4+ & Qxh2 is
worth the pain that results - I think black can wind his way through the
complications but he's basically ruling out kingside castling and
spotting white a big lead in development.
